Two weeks ago, IKEA made the decision to close all of its stores in the UK to help combat the risk of spreading coronavirus.
However, stores like B&Q, Homebase and Wickes have all since reopened physical shops, allowing the public to go in and buy DIY and repair 'essentials'.
Now it looks like IKEA could follow their lead, as it has been suggested that all stores will reopen to shoppers in just a matter of weeks.
According to the Mirror, sources said the proposed reopening date is May 18 for its 18 stores in the UK. However, IKEA is refusing to confirm an opening date, and whether stores will reopen this month or not.
